When you are looking at the price of a new water heater, a few main things shift the final number. The type of unit you choose—whether it is a tank model or a tankless system—is the biggest factor. You also have to consider the fuel source, like gas or electric, and the physical space where the heater sits. If your home needs new venting, updated piping, or a different hookup to meet current safety codes, that adds labor time to the project.

Replacing a 50-gallon water heater in Billings involves disconnecting the old unit, draining it, and installing the new one. This includes connecting water lines, gas or electric supply, and venting. Pros ensure all connections are secure and the unit is functioning correctly. They will also dispose of the old unit properly. This process guarantees your new heater is ready for use.

Signs that indicate a need for water heater replacement in Billings include frequent leaks, discolored water, or a lack of hot water. Unusual noises like popping or rumbling can also signal internal issues. If your unit is over 10-12 years old, it may be nearing the end of its lifespan. Pros can inspect your system and advise on the most cost-effective solution.
In Billings, the average lifespan of a storage tank water heater is typically 10-12 years. Tankless water heaters, with proper maintenance, can last 20 years or more. Factors like water quality and usage patterns can influence longevity. Professionals can help you maintain your current unit to maximize its lifespan and advise when replacement is the best option. Water heater anode rod replacement in Billings is a crucial maintenance task that significantly extends the life of your tank. The anode rod sacrifices itself to prevent corrosion within the tank. Replacing it periodically protects the tank from rust and leaks. Pros can inspect and replace the anode rod during routine service. This proactive measure prevents premature failure of your unit.
